Who funds Contemporary Art for San Antonio?

Contemporary Art for San Antonio is funded by 11 grantmakers, led by The Brown Foundation Inc ($133K), San Antonio Area Foundation ($82K), John R & Greli N Less Charitable Trust ($75K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$381K in grants to Contemporary Art for San Antonio between 2020–2025.
